A sportsbook is a place where people can make bets on a variety of sporting events. These are usually legal companies, but some are not. A sportsbook takes winning wagers and pays them out to its customers. The rest of the money is used for overhead costs, such as rent, utilities, payroll, and software. To run a successful sportsbook, you need to have good cash flow to cover the overhead expenses.
In the US, sportsbooks are becoming more popular as they become available in more states and online. However, it’s important to do your research before making a bet. Look for a sportsbook with a good reputation and a license to operate in your state. You should also read reviews about the sportsbook to find out what other players liked or disliked about it.
Before placing a bet, you should read the rules of each sportsbook. You should also know what types of bets are accepted and the odds that they offer. You can learn a lot about a sportsbook by looking at its website. Most sportsbooks will have clearly labeled odds that you can use to compare them with other sportsbooks.
When choosing a sportsbook, look for one that offers the sports you like to bet on. Some sportsbooks may only offer bets on the major sports, such as football and baseball, while others might have more niche options, such as boxing or hockey. Some sportsbooks even offer handicapping services. These are useful for people who want to try their hand at picking winners.
Sportsbooks offer a variety of betting lines for each event, including spreads and moneylines. Spreads are odds that indicate how much a team or player is expected to win, while moneylines are the amount a person can win on a bet. Some sportsbooks will list the odds for individual teams, while others will only list the total number of points a game is likely to have.
The odds for each sport vary throughout the year, depending on whether the sports are in season or not. The volume of bets varies as well, and certain sports can create peaks in activity. For example, when the NFL season starts, the betting action at many sportsbooks will increase dramatically.
In addition to reading the terms and conditions of each sportsbook, you should also check if it is legal in your state. You can do this by referring to your state’s government website or by calling a lawyer who is familiar with iGaming laws. It is also a good idea to visit the sportsbook in person before depositing any funds. This way, you can get a feel for the atmosphere and see if it is the right fit for you. If it is not, you can always move on to another site.